Tracking link
What is Tracking link?
A tracking link is a customized web address that monitors user activity and tracks attribution sources through unique parameters appended to URLs. Tracking links enable marketers to distinguish between different traffic sources, user journeys, and conversion paths by embedding specific codes or identifiers that capture data when users click through to destinations.
How it works
Tracking links function by appending parameters to standard URLs that identify specific marketing activities, campaigns, or traffic sources. When users click these links, the parameters are captured and recorded by analytics tools or mobile measurement partners.
Parameter Structure
Tracking links consist of a base URL followed by parameters that define the traffic source, campaign details, and other attribution data. Common parameters include source, medium, campaign name, content variation, and term targeting. These parameters follow standardized formats like UTM (Urchin Tracking Module) to ensure consistent data collection across platforms.
Mobile-Specific Functions
In mobile marketing, tracking links provide additional capabilities beyond basic attribution. They implement deep linking functionality to direct users to specific in-app pages, or deferred deep linking that remembers destination data for users who need to install the app first. These links also handle cross-platform redirection, ensuring users reach the appropriate app store or web destination based on their device.
Data Collection Process
When clicked, tracking links capture timestamp data, device information, user behavior patterns, and attribution signals. This data feeds into attribution models that determine which touchpoints deserve credit for conversions and revenue generation. The collected information enables marketers to trace the complete customer journey from initial click to final conversion.

How to Set Up Tracking Links
Setting up effective tracking links requires choosing the right parameters and maintaining consistent naming conventions across campaigns.
Step 1: Define Parameter Strategy Select parameters that align with your attribution needs. Essential parameters include source (where traffic originates), medium (type of marketing channel), campaign (specific campaign name), content (creative variation), and term (keyword targeting). Establish clear naming conventions to ensure consistency across teams and campaigns.
Step 2: Implement URL Structure Construct tracking links by appending parameters to your base URL using the format: baseurl.com?parameter1=value1¶meter2=value2. For mobile apps, integrate with deep linking capabilities to direct users to specific in-app destinations while maintaining attribution data.
Step 3: Configure Analytics Integration Connect tracking links to your analytics platform or mobile measurement partner to ensure data collection. Configure postback URLs to receive conversion data and set up attribution windows that align with your customer journey length.
Step 4: Test and Validate Test tracking links across different devices and platforms to ensure proper functionality. Verify that attribution data flows correctly to your analytics dashboard and that deep linking works as intended for mobile users.
Step 5: Monitor and Optimize Regularly analyze tracking link performance to identify high-converting sources and optimize campaign allocation. Use the attribution data to refine targeting, creative strategies, and budget distribution across channels.
